/**
* @file lv_fs_stdio.c
*
*/
/*********************
* INCLUDES
*********************/
#include "../../../lvgl.h"
#if LV_USE_FS_STDIO != '\0'
#include <stdio.h>
#include <errno.h>
#ifndef WIN32
#include <dirent.h>
#include <unistd.h>
#else
#include <windows.h>
#endif
/*********************
* DEFINES
*********************/
#ifndef LV_FS_STDIO_PATH
# ifndef WIN32
# define LV_FS_STDIO_PATH "./" /*Project root*/
# else
# define LV_FS_STDIO_PATH ".\\" /*Project root*/
# endif
#endif /*LV_FS_STDIO_PATH*/
/**********************
* TYPEDEFS
**********************/
/**********************
* STATIC PROTOTYPES
**********************/
static void * fs_open(lv_fs_drv_t * drv, const char * path, lv_fs_mode_t mode);
static lv_fs_res_t fs_close(lv_fs_drv_t * drv, void * file_p);
static lv_fs_res_t fs_read(lv_fs_drv_t * drv, void * file_p, void * buf, uint32_t btr, uint32_t * br);
static lv_fs_res_t fs_write(lv_fs_drv_t * drv, void * file_p, const void * buf, uint32_t btw, uint32_t * bw);
static lv_fs_res_t fs_seek(lv_fs_drv_t * drv, void * file_p, uint32_t pos, lv_fs_whence_t whence);
static lv_fs_res_t fs_tell(lv_fs_drv_t * drv, void * file_p, uint32_t * pos_p);
static void * fs_dir_open(lv_fs_drv_t * drv, const char * path);
static lv_fs_res_t fs_dir_read(lv_fs_drv_t * drv, void * dir_p, char * fn);
static lv_fs_res_t fs_dir_close(lv_fs_drv_t * drv, void * dir_p);
/**********************
* STATIC VARIABLES
**********************/
/**********************
* MACROS
**********************/
/**********************
* GLOBAL FUNCTIONS
**********************/
/**
* Register a driver for the File system interface
*/
void lv_fs_stdio_init(void)
{
/*---------------------------------------------------
* Register the file system interface in LittlevGL
*--------------------------------------------------*/
/* Add a simple drive to open images */
static lv_fs_drv_t fs_drv; /*A driver descriptor*/
lv_fs_drv_init(&fs_drv);
/*Set up fields...*/
fs_drv.letter = LV_USE_FS_STDIO;
fs_drv.open_cb = fs_open;
fs_drv.close_cb = fs_close;
fs_drv.read_cb = fs_read;
fs_drv.write_cb = fs_write;
fs_drv.seek_cb = fs_seek;
fs_drv.tell_cb = fs_tell;
fs_drv.dir_close_cb = fs_dir_close;
fs_drv.dir_open_cb = fs_dir_open;
fs_drv.dir_read_cb = fs_dir_read;
lv_fs_drv_register(&fs_drv);
}
/**********************
* STATIC FUNCTIONS
**********************/
/**
* Open a file
* @param drv pointer to a driver where this function belongs
* @param path path to the file beginning with the driver letter (e.g. S:/folder/file.txt)
* @param mode read: FS_MODE_RD, write: FS_MODE_WR, both: FS_MODE_RD | FS_MODE_WR
* @return pointer to FIL struct or NULL in case of fail
*/
static void * fs_open(lv_fs_drv_t * drv, const char * path, lv_fs_mode_t mode)
{
LV_UNUSED(drv);
errno = 0;
const char * flags = "";
if(mode == LV_FS_MODE_WR) flags = "wb";
else if(mode == LV_FS_MODE_RD) flags = "rb";
else if(mode == (LV_FS_MODE_WR | LV_FS_MODE_RD)) flags = "rb+";
/*Make the path relative to the current directory (the projects root folder)*/
char buf[256];
sprintf(buf, LV_FS_STDIO_PATH "%s", path);
FILE * f = fopen(buf, flags);
if(f == NULL) return NULL;
/*Be sure we are the beginning of the file*/
fseek(f, 0, SEEK_SET);
return f;
}
/**
* Close an opened file
* @param drv pointer to a driver where this function belongs
* @param file_p pointer to a FILE variable. (opened with fs_open)
* @return LV_FS_RES_OK: no error, the file is read
* any error from lv_fs_res_t enum
*/
static lv_fs_res_t fs_close(lv_fs_drv_t * drv, void * file_p)
{
LV_UNUSED(drv);
fclose(file_p);
return LV_FS_RES_OK;
}
/**
* Read data from an opened file
* @param drv pointer to a driver where this function belongs
* @param file_p pointer to a FILE variable.
* @param buf pointer to a memory block where to store the read data
* @param btr number of Bytes To Read
* @param br the real number of read bytes (Byte Read)
* @return LV_FS_RES_OK: no error, the file is read
* any error from lv_fs_res_t enum
*/
static lv_fs_res_t fs_read(lv_fs_drv_t * drv, void * file_p, void * buf, uint32_t btr, uint32_t * br)
{
LV_UNUSED(drv);
*br = fread(buf, 1, btr, file_p);
return LV_FS_RES_OK;
}
/**
* Write into a file
* @param drv pointer to a driver where this function belongs
* @param file_p pointer to a FILE variable
* @param buf pointer to a buffer with the bytes to write
* @param btr Bytes To Write
* @param br the number of real written bytes (Bytes Written). NULL if unused.
* @return LV_FS_RES_OK or any error from lv_fs_res_t enum
*/
static lv_fs_res_t fs_write(lv_fs_drv_t * drv, void * file_p, const void * buf, uint32_t btw, uint32_t * bw)
{
LV_UNUSED(drv);
*bw = fwrite(buf, 1, btw, file_p);
return LV_FS_RES_OK;
}
/**
* Set the read write pointer. Also expand the file size if necessary.
* @param drv pointer to a driver where this function belongs
* @param file_p pointer to a FILE variable. (opened with fs_open )
* @param pos the new position of read write pointer
* @return LV_FS_RES_OK: no error, the file is read
* any error from lv_fs_res_t enum
*/
static lv_fs_res_t fs_seek(lv_fs_drv_t * drv, void * file_p, uint32_t pos, lv_fs_whence_t whence)
{
LV_UNUSED(drv);
fseek(file_p, pos, whence);
return LV_FS_RES_OK;
}
/**
* Give the position of the read write pointer
* @param drv pointer to a driver where this function belongs
* @param file_p pointer to a FILE variable.
* @param pos_p pointer to to store the result
* @return LV_FS_RES_OK: no error, the file is read
* any error from lv_fs_res_t enum
*/
static lv_fs_res_t fs_tell(lv_fs_drv_t * drv, void * file_p, uint32_t * pos_p)
{
LV_UNUSED(drv);
*pos_p = ftell(file_p);
return LV_FS_RES_OK;
}
#ifdef WIN32
static char next_fn[256];
#endif
/**
* Initialize a 'DIR' or 'HANDLE' variable for directory reading
* @param drv pointer to a driver where this function belongs
* @param path path to a directory
* @return pointer to an initialized 'DIR' or 'HANDLE' variable
*/
static void * fs_dir_open(lv_fs_drv_t * drv, const char * path)
{
LV_UNUSED(drv);
#ifndef WIN32
/*Make the path relative to the current directory (the projects root folder)*/
char buf[256];
sprintf(buf, LV_FS_STDIO_PATH "%s", path);
return opendir(buf);
#else
HANDLE d = INVALID_HANDLE_VALUE;
WIN32_FIND_DATA fdata;
/*Make the path relative to the current directory (the projects root folder)*/
char buf[256];
sprintf(buf, LV_FS_STDIO_PATH "%s\\*", path);
strcpy(next_fn, "");
d = FindFirstFile(buf, &fdata);
do {
if (strcmp(fdata.cFileName, ".") == 0 || strcmp(fdata.cFileName, "..") == 0) {
continue;
} else {
if (fdata.dwFileAttributes & FILE_ATTRIBUTE_DIRECTORY) {
sprintf(next_fn, "/%s", fdata.cFileName);
} else {
sprintf(next_fn, "%s", fdata.cFileName);
}
break;
}
} while(FindNextFileA(d, &fdata));
return d;
#endif
}
/**
* Read the next filename form a directory.
* The name of the directories will begin with '/'
* @param drv pointer to a driver where this function belongs
* @param dir_p pointer to an initialized 'DIR' or 'HANDLE' variable
* @param fn pointer to a buffer to store the filename
* @return LV_FS_RES_OK or any error from lv_fs_res_t enum
*/
static lv_fs_res_t fs_dir_read(lv_fs_drv_t * drv, void * dir_p, char * fn)
{
LV_UNUSED(drv);
#ifndef WIN32
struct dirent *entry;
do {
entry = readdir(dir_p);
if(entry) {
if(entry->d_type == DT_DIR) sprintf(fn, "/%s", entry->d_name);
else strcpy(fn, entry->d_name);
} else {
strcpy(fn, "");
}
} while(strcmp(fn, "/.") == 0 || strcmp(fn, "/..") == 0);
#else
strcpy(fn, next_fn);
strcpy(next_fn, "");
WIN32_FIND_DATA fdata;
if(FindNextFile(dir_p, &fdata) == false) return LV_FS_RES_OK;
do {
if (strcmp(fdata.cFileName, ".") == 0 || strcmp(fdata.cFileName, "..") == 0) {
continue;
} else {
if (fdata.dwFileAttributes & FILE_ATTRIBUTE_DIRECTORY) {
sprintf(next_fn, "/%s", fdata.cFileName);
} else {
sprintf(next_fn, "%s", fdata.cFileName);
}
break;
}
} while(FindNextFile(dir_p, &fdata));
#endif
return LV_FS_RES_OK;
}
/**
* Close the directory reading
* @param drv pointer to a driver where this function belongs
* @param dir_p pointer to an initialized 'DIR' or 'HANDLE' variable
* @return LV_FS_RES_OK or any error from lv_fs_res_t enum
*/
static lv_fs_res_t fs_dir_close(lv_fs_drv_t * drv, void * dir_p)
{
LV_UNUSED(drv);
#ifndef WIN32
closedir(dir_p);
#else
FindClose(dir_p);
#endif
return LV_FS_RES_OK;
}
#endif /*LV_USE_FS_STDIO*/
